Question
Statements: P > Q < R; T ≤ U ≤ Q > S; V ≤
W < T Conclusions: I). P > V II). T = S III). R > V In the question, assuming the given statements to be true, find which of the conclusion (s) among the given three conclusions is /are definitely true and then give your answer accordingly.Solution
Given statements: P > Q < R; T ≤ U ≤ Q > S; V ≤ W < T Conclusions: I). P > V: True (As P > Q ≥ U ≥ T > W ≥ V, So, P > V) II). T = S: False (As T ≤ U ≤ Q > S, the relation between T and S is not determined) III). R > V: True (As R > Q ≥ U ≥ T > W ≥ V, so R > V)
